Murder on the Moon
Originally released in 1989. Murder on the Moon is a mystery/science fiction film. directed by Michael Lindsay-Hogg.
Starring Brigitte Nielsen, Julian Sands, and Gerald McRaney
Synopsis
After a nuclear war on Earth, the Soviet Union and the U.S. both establish outposts on the moon. When a murder occurs on the outpost, both U.S. and Soviet investigators are forced to work on the case together.
